Farmer destroys standing crop chillies, blames price crash, lack of market facility

Lockdown and shutting of markets have had cascading effects on farmers as their produce have ended up rotting due to lack of transportation and price crash. Now, a farmer in Karnataka’s Gadag destroyed his two acres of chillies by a running tractor over the crop.

Frustrated with price crash and lack of transportation, a farmer from Abbigeri in Karnataka’s Gadag destroyed his standing crop by running a tractor over his 2-acre produce.

The farmer is identified as Basavaraj. He said that due to lockdown, the markets were shut and the price of the produce crashed drastically. With no support from the government, he had taken this decision out of anger to ran his tractor over his 2-acre land of chillies
